Transaction ecf61cea70b5e4bc5b74592a1de575ec842dcaaaf7b59a60cd01ffaf31828b12

1 Input
2 Outputs
  • ecf61cea70b5e4bc5b74592a1de575ec842dcaaaf7b59a60cd01ffaf31828b12:0
  • value  120880708
    address  3G48maqe2saDivCghgXMJSiKxLnGydJ23Q
  • ecf61cea70b5e4bc5b74592a1de575ec842dcaaaf7b59a60cd01ffaf31828b12:1
  • value  103940805
    address  3Aug66vKy1ZtM5sbF4UfyfWEUkkmaK7Tsi